I am trying to record my analog 4track signal to my computer. I'm using cool edit, but other programs have the same effect...

If I plug my 4track stereo out into the "mic" input on my sound card, I can record but obviously everything is way overdriven. I can't monitor the output through the computer's speakers and individual track's pan control doesn't work.

If I plug my 4track stereo out into the "line in" input I can monitor the playback through the computer and the pan control works ok. The problem is that when I hit record on cool edit (or anything else I have) I can see the db meter levels changing but when I hit stop there's nothing recorded.

Anyone care to share some wisdom? And don't be afraid to "dumb it down".
 
Mic input is BBBBAAAAAADDDDDDDD. Dont use it - FOR ANYTHING!- Make sure you have a track armed to record in Cool Edit- and make sure you have the correct source selected
